YouTube CEO wants governments pass laws to "have more control over online speech"

 

Susan Wojcicki, the CEO of YouTube, has acknowledged that the platform’s policy of censoring legal content that it deems to be “harmful” is controversial and urged governments to step in and pass stronger speech laws. Wojcicki made the comments in an interview with the Hamburg-based independent broadcaster TIDETVhamburg where she was asked about how the platform navigates the “minefield” or complying with national laws while also keeping advertisers happy and users interested.
